New England Patriots kicker Stephen Gostkowski is now the highest-paid kicker in the league, according to Albert Breer of NFL Network.
Related: Patriots place franchise tag on kicker Stephen Gostkowski
The veteran signed his $4.58-million franchise offer Friday and, barring a long-term contract extension, is guaranteed that salary for 2015.
Gostkowski converted 35 of 37 field goals in 2014 and has been one of the league's best kickers over the past four seasons.
